Occupants hit a high-rise building in Kherson: one dead and one injured

(Photo: Kherson MBA)

In Kherson region, a woman was killed and dozens of people were injured as a result of Russian strikes. More than three dozen settlements of the region, including Beryslav, Bilozerka, Antonivka, Komyshany, Stanislav, Novovorontsovka and the city of Kherson, came under enemy drone terror and artillery fire.

According to Oleksandr Prokudin, the head of the Kherson Military District Administration, the attacks hit critical and social infrastructure, as well as residential areas. The attacks damaged 11 multi-story buildings and 25 private houses, an outbuilding, a gas pipeline, agricultural machinery and private cars.

According to the regional military administration, 19 people, including one child, were injured as a result of the Russian aggression. Seven residents were also evacuated from frontline communities in the region.

In turn, the Kherson Regional Prosecutor's Office reported that as of 5:30 p.m. on June 2, they had 10 people wounded in Russian attacks. A 16-year-old girl was among the injured. Three civilians were injured during artillery shelling of Kherson and Bilozerka. Another seven people were injured by enemy drone attacks in Kherson and Vysoke village.

In addition, law enforcement officers are investigating another war crime committed by the Russian military, which resulted in the death of a civilian. According to the investigation, at around 23:30, a Russian drone attacked a multi-story building in Kherson.

An 86-year-old woman died as a result of the strike. Three local residents sustained injuries of varying severity, and three more people suffered carbon monoxide poisoning. All of them were in their apartments at the time of the attack.

Also, according to law enforcement officials, on the morning of June 3, at about 04:00, the Russian military struck a residential building in Kherson with a drone.

As a result of the attack, three local residents were injured, including a 17-year-old boy.

Law enforcement officers have opened criminal proceedings over the shelling and drone attacks under the article on war crimes and continue to document the consequences of Russian aggression.
